I\u2019m not sure what those titles will be yet, last year I read <a href=\"https:\/\/www.thelauriegilmore.com\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">Laurie Gilmore<\/a>\u2019s <a href=\"https:\/\/www.thelauriegilmore.com\/books\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\"><strong>The Cinnamon Bun Book Store<\/strong><\/a> and <a href=\"https:\/\/www.thelauriegilmore.com\/books\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\"><strong>The Pumpkin Spice Caf\u00e9<\/strong><\/a><strong>.<\/strong> \ud83c\udf83\ud83c\udf42<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ong><em>Movies to watch:<\/em><\/strong><\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">In our homeschool US History lessons we are moving into the 1950\u2019s. So Jim and I plan to enjoy watching classic movies set in that time period.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">I am specifically excited about the ones that feel like the fall season.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li><strong>October Sky<\/strong> &#8211; set in October 1957, news of the Soviet Union\u2018s launch of Sputnik 1 reaches Homer Hickam in the mining community in West Virginia. Homer is inspired to build his own rockets despite the skepticism of his friends and family.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Mona Lisa Smile <\/strong>&#8211; set in 1953, Katherine Watson (Julia Roberts) accepts an Art History teaching position at Wellesley College. She introduces modern art and encourages discussion about what art is. Katherine also challenges her students to achieve more in life than what society is expecting.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Dead Poets Society<\/strong> &#8211; set in 1959 at a fictional elite boarding school called Welton Academy. It tells the story of an English teacher (Robin Williams) who inspires his students through his unique teaching of poetry.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">{<em>I like adding to my own personal learning with this form of visual story telling.
